Global Currency Table (Extended)
Below is an extended list of countries and their official currencies, including codes and symbols:
Country | Currency | Currency Code | Symbol |
---|---|---|---|
United States | US Dollar | USD | $ |
India | Indian Rupee | INR | ₹ |
Japan | Japanese Yen | JPY | ¥ |
European Union | Euro | EUR | € |
United Kingdom | Pound Sterling | GBP | £ |
Australia | Australian Dollar | AUD | A$ |
Canada | Canadian Dollar | CAD | C$ |
China | Renminbi (Yuan) | CNY | ¥ |
Russia | Russian Ruble | RUB | ₽ |
Brazil | Brazilian Real | BRL | R$ |
Saudi Arabia | Saudi Riyal | SAR | ﷼ |
South Korea | South Korean Won | KRW | ₩ |
South Africa | South African Rand | ZAR | R |
Mexico | Mexican Peso | MXN | $ |
Indonesia | Indonesian Rupiah | IDR | Rp |
Turkey | Turkish Lira | TRY | ₺ |
Switzerland | Swiss Franc | CHF | Fr |
Argentina | Argentine Peso | ARS | $ |
Egypt | Egyptian Pound | EGP | £ |
Thailand | Thai Baht | THB | ฿ |
Vietnam | Vietnamese Dong | VND | ₫ |
Pakistan | Pakistani Rupee | PKR | ₨ |
Nigeria | Nigerian Naira | NGN | ₦ |
Bangladesh | Bangladeshi Taka | BDT | ৳ |
Malaysia | Malaysian Ringgit | MYR | RM |
UAE | UAE Dirham | AED | د.إ |

Frequently Asked Questions
1. What is the most traded currency in the world?
The US Dollar (USD) is the most traded and widely used reserve currency globally.
2. Which currency is the strongest?
The Kuwaiti Dinar (KWD) is considered the strongest currency in terms of value per unit.
3. What is the difference between a currency symbol and a currency code?
A currency symbol (like $, ₹) is a visual representation. A currency code (like USD, INR) is a standardized 3-letter code defined by ISO 4217.
4. How often do exchange rates change?
Exchange rates can change multiple times a day due to market conditions, demand-supply, and global news.
